AI语音开发套件与图像识别的结合教程

在当今这个科技飞速发展的时代,人工智能(AI)技术已经渗透到了我们生活的方方面面。其中,AI语音开发套件与图像识别的结合更是为开发者们带来了无限的可能。本文将讲述一位AI技术爱好者的故事,通过他的实践经历,带我们深入了解如何将AI语音开发套件与图像识别技术相结合。

李明,一个普通的大学计算机专业毕业生,对AI技术充满了浓厚的兴趣。自从接触到了AI语音开发套件和图像识别技术,他决定将这两者结合起来,创造出一个全新的智能应用。在这个过程中,他遇到了许多困难,但也收获了许多宝贵的经验。

一、初识AI语音开发套件与图像识别

李明在大学期间就曾接触到AI语音开发套件,那时他就被其强大的语音识别和合成功能所吸引。同时,他也对图像识别技术产生了浓厚的兴趣。他认为,将语音和图像识别结合起来,可以实现更智能的人机交互。

为了实现这一目标,李明开始研究AI语音开发套件和图像识别技术的相关知识。他发现,许多优秀的AI语音开发套件,如百度语音开放平台、科大讯飞开放平台等,都提供了丰富的API接口,方便开发者进行二次开发。同时,图像识别技术也在不断发展,如OpenCV、TensorFlow等开源框架,为开发者提供了强大的图像处理能力。

二、项目构思与规划

在了解了AI语音开发套件和图像识别技术后,李明开始构思他的项目。他希望通过这个项目,实现一个能够实时识别图像中的文字,并将其转换为语音输出的智能应用。这样,用户可以通过语音与设备进行交互,大大提高使用便利性。

为了实现这个目标,李明将项目分为以下几个阶段:

  1. 数据收集与预处理:收集大量的图像数据,并对这些数据进行预处理,如去噪、缩放等。

  2. 模型训练:使用深度学习算法,如卷积神经网络(CNN)等,对图像数据进行训练,使其能够识别图像中的文字。

  3. 语音合成:利用AI语音开发套件,将识别出的文字转换为语音输出。

  4. 系统集成:将图像识别和语音合成模块集成到一起,实现一个完整的智能应用。

三、项目实施与优化

在项目实施过程中,李明遇到了许多困难。首先,在数据收集与预处理阶段,他发现图像数据的质量对模型的识别效果有很大影响。因此,他花费了大量时间对数据进行清洗和优化。

其次,在模型训练阶段,由于图像数据量较大,训练过程需要消耗大量时间和计算资源。为了提高训练效率,李明尝试了多种优化方法,如使用GPU加速训练、调整网络结构等。

在语音合成阶段,李明遇到了语音输出质量不稳定的问题。为了解决这个问题,他尝试了多种语音合成算法,并对输出结果进行调试,最终找到了一种较为满意的解决方案。

在系统集成阶段,李明将图像识别和语音合成模块进行了整合,实现了实时识别图像中的文字并转换为语音输出的功能。然而,在实际使用过程中,他发现系统存在一定的延迟。为了解决这个问题,他通过优化算法和调整系统参数,最终将延迟降低到了可接受的范围。

四、项目成果与应用

经过几个月的努力,李明的项目终于完成了。他开发的智能应用能够实时识别图像中的文字,并将其转换为语音输出,为用户提供了便捷的使用体验。这款应用在校园内得到了广泛的应用,受到了同学们的一致好评。

此外,李明还计划将这个项目推广到更广泛的领域,如智能家居、智能客服等。他相信,通过AI语音开发套件与图像识别技术的结合,可以创造出更多具有实用价值的智能应用。

五、总结

李明的故事告诉我们,只要有热情和毅力,就能够将AI语音开发套件与图像识别技术相结合,创造出具有实际应用价值的智能产品。在这个过程中,我们需要不断学习、实践和优化,才能取得成功。而对于我们这些AI技术爱好者来说,这无疑是一次充满挑战和乐趣的旅程。

猜你喜欢:AI翻译